How much do fractional strategy jobs pay per year?

As of Jul 24, 2026, the average yearly pay for fractional strategy in the United States is $144,255.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$112,500.00 and $162,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

How does a Fractional Strategy consultant typically integrate with client teams, and what collaboration challenges might arise?

As a Fractional Strategy consultant, you will often work with executive teams and department leads on a part-time or project basis. Integration usually involves quickly assessing the organization's current strategic landscape, aligning with key stakeholders, and facilitating workshops or planning sessions. A common challenge is building trust and rapport in a short timeframe, as well as adapting to each client's unique culture and processes. Successful consultants are proactive communicators and flexible collaborators, ensuring they deliver value while navigating varying expectations and team dynamics.

What is a Fractional Strategy professional?

A Fractional Strategy professional is an experienced strategist who works with organizations on a part-time, contract, or project basis to help shape and execute business strategies. Instead of hiring a full-time Chief Strategy Officer or similar executive, companies engage fractional strategists to access high-level expertise and insights without the long-term commitment or cost of a full-time hire. These professionals typically support leadership teams with strategic planning, market analysis, growth initiatives, and organizational change. The arrangement offers flexibility and tailored support, particularly for startups or small to mid-sized businesses.

What is a fractional strategist?

A fractional strategist is a professional who provides strategic planning and advisory services to organizations on a part-time or contract basis, rather than as a full-time employee. They typically work with multiple clients, offering expertise in areas such as business growth, market positioning, and operational efficiency, often utilizing tools like strategic frameworks and data analysis. This role is common in startups and small to medium-sized businesses seeking specialized guidance without the cost of a full-time executive.

Fractional CFO

Alta Advisors

San Francisco, CA • Remote

Contractor

Posted 17 days ago


Job description

Overview:
Alta Advisors is a boutique strategic finance and accounting firm that supports some of the most ambitious venture-backed startups in deeptech, hardtech and applied AI. Our clients include companies in AI, robotics, aerospace, healthtech and cleantech backed by top-tier VCs such as Lightspeed, Coatue, Eclipse, Founders Fund, DCVC and more.

We are expanding our elite team of finance leaders and are hiring an experienced Fractional CFO to support our growing roster of clients. This is an opportunity to join an exceptional group of operators and work at the highest levels of startup finance.

The Role:
As a Fractional CFO at Alta Advisors, you will be the primary finance partner to multiple venture-backed startups. You will drive strategic decision-making, oversee financial operations, lead fundraising efforts, and provide Board and investor-ready reporting. You will be supported by a high-caliber team of FP&A and accounting professionals, including alumni of Big 4 accounting firms and bulge bracket investment banks, enabling you to focus your time on strategic, high-impact leadership.

This role is ideal for a seasoned senior finance leader—someone who has served as a CFO or VP of Finance in high-growth venture-backed startups and is eager to make an impact across multiple companies while building a thriving fractional CFO practice.

Responsibilities:

  • Serve as CFO to Alta’s venture-backed startup clients, providing strategic leadership and financial oversight
  • Lead high-level financial strategy, Board communications, and executive reporting
  • Oversee FP&A, including forecasting, budgeting, and performance management
  • Oversee accounting, financial reporting, compliance, and coordination of tax and audit processes
  • Support capital raising processes, including preparation of financial materials and investor communications
  • Manage internal teams to ensure high-quality delivery of accounting, FP&A, and financial operations
  • Manage client scope, profitability, and identify opportunities for upsell or expansion
     

Qualifications:

  • 15+ years total experience in finance, with strong accounting fluency
  • 3+ years in a CFO or VP Finance role at high-growth venture-backed startups
  • Strong technical accounting experience required; CPA strongly preferred
  • Experience supporting capital-intensive businesses in sectors like deeptech, hardtech, and applied AI
  • Experience with capital raising and investor management
  • Strong modeling and presentation skills (Google Sheets + Slides)
  • Excellent communication and executive presence
  • Able to manage multiple client relationships and scale supporting teams to deliver high-quality service efficiently
